The whole time I thought Vad Deverel was going to end up being a vampire or something and that never happened. So that was a touch disappointing. The smut could have been a touch better, but I won't complain.
I suck at reviews, but all-in-all, a good story. Definitely New Adult vibes. At first I was under the impression that this was set in an older timeline, however it was fairly modern with random things like the use of phones and internet was stuck in. Some of the writing was kind of cringy and I sped read through a LOT of fluffy bits that simply weren't all that necessary to have even been put into writing. Overall, good book. If Goodreads would do a 1/2 star system, this would be a solid 3.5 for me but I rounded up for the sake of having enjoyed the plot twist at the end bc I never would have seen it coming. So I honestly absolutely loved this book, despite a few nagging problems. If you like gothic dark romance and a dark academic setting, this is 1000% for you.
⚠️TWs: graphic depictions of loved ones completing suicide; explicit sexual content; student-professer; descriptions of hallucinations (possible psychosis); death
🌑 Things I loved: The dark academia setting -- immersive and majorly enthralling. The callbacks to classic gothic horror. The blurred line between paranormal and psychological. The different subplots that wove interestingly together. The passion/madness of the romantic relationship. Daddy Dom Vad.
